    Maybe "build" is the incorrect term for this forum? I'm use to Jeep forums where replacing stock parts is called a build even if its minimal.

    So far on the Cambo, I replaced the standard ground glass for a brighter screen, cut a few lens boards for various lenses that I don't believe came standard with a Cambo, attached a tape measure along the rail for easy bellows measurements. Soon to add a cold shoe, Fresnel screen, and make a single cord for my wireless trigger instead of using three different connectors. I didn't make any of the pieces by hand but they've been replaced or pieced together. It's been fun either way

    Re: Show off your Large Format camera!

    Thanks for the clarification.

    FWIW, new view cameras are usually sold without lenses and lens boards. They're normally sold with backs, and the backs usually contain a focusing panel. The purchaser supplies both. Used cameras are often sold fully equipped and ready to use.

    When your fresnel arrives, make sure to put it behind the ground glass. That's between the gg and you. If you put it in front of the gg, the gg will be out of register with the film holder, not a good thing.
